How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Licking County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Licking County Studio Apartments | $812 | $795 | $883 |
| Licking County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,196 | $729 | $1,500 |
| Licking County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,812 | $632 | $10,000+ |
| Licking County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,945 | $771 | $2,675 |
| Licking County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,850 | $2,850 | $2,850 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Corporate Licking County Apartments
What is the Cheapest Corporate apartment in Licking County?
Currently the most affordable Corporate Apartment in Licking County is at 31 N 3rd St listed at $1,200.
How much is the average rent for a Corporate Licking County Apartment?
The average rent for a Corporate Apartment in Licking County is $1,237.
What is the largest Corporate Licking County Apartment for rent?
Today's Corporate apartment with the most square footage in Licking County is a 703 square feet unit starting from $1,200 at 31 N 3rd St.
What is the average size for Licking County Corporate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Corporate rental in Licking County is currently at 600 sq ft.
